Conclave Overview |
India-China Economic Conclave 2008 is the 4th annual
event under India China Economic and Cultural Council’s (ICEC)
India-China Economic Programme. The conclave will be held on
18-19 February 2009 in New Delhi. The conclave is organized by ICEC Council in collaboration with China Chamber of
International Commerce and Rajiv Gandhi Foundation. The conclave
strives to increase awareness of the many opportunities in India
and China for economic cooperation.
The main theme of the conference is:
|
|
“The
Emerging Economic Partnership”.
The focus of the discussion will be
on Information Technology, Telecom, Finance, Power,
Healthcare and Construction Sector. |
